Common use of Wage shortfalls Clause in Contracts

Wage shortfalls. Where the Employer is informed in writing that the Employee has not been paid the full amount of wages due to the Employee in a fortnightly pay the Employer shall investigate the matter. Where an underpayment is confirmed and determined to be the fault of the Employer, the Employer shall pay the shortfall to the Employee in the next fortnightly pay.
